Poorly Implemented Database

Poorly designed or produced databases include incomplete information in various rows, ambiguity or uncertainty, complex and often invasive attempts, and uncertain information in the database. A poorly constructed dataset is inefficient, demanding, and maintenance-oriented, and it cannot address the actual working circumstances. Any organization has a significant database since it contains all information about the company, its suppliers, and its customers. The database design varies depending on the company’s strategy (Badia, 2015).
